Output 115fda219040bbe3fb9e8d00a752cf161d2c093785b9fcf7b783caef8600cf88:0

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bc611322cb40928c4ed2705b7a97b07be7b5fd8 OP_EQUAL
address
37954owUFvcqvP5w8EhifTADurLWp7sXFM
transaction
115fda219040bbe3fb9e8d00a752cf161d2c093785b9fcf7b783caef8600cf88
confirmations
112381
spent
false